Move E2EE and emote module to their own directories
This commit is contained in:
parent
b3ba1aef13
commit
4aa38f4582
|
@ -9,7 +9,7 @@
|
|||
*/
|
||||
|
||||
import { Settings, Cache, Events } from 'modules';
|
||||
import BuiltinModule from './BuiltinModule';
|
||||
import BuiltinModule from '../BuiltinModule';
|
||||
import { Reflection, ReactComponents, MonkeyPatch, Patcher, DiscordApi, Security } from 'modules';
|
||||
import { VueInjector, Modals, Toasts } from 'ui';
|
||||
import { ClientLogger as Logger, ClientIPC } from 'common';
|
|
@ -45,7 +45,7 @@
|
|||
import { E2EE } from 'builtin';
|
||||
import { Settings, DiscordApi, Reflection } from 'modules';
|
||||
import { Toasts } from 'ui';
|
||||
import { MiLock, MiImagePlus, MiIcVpnKey } from '../ui/components/common/MaterialIcon';
|
||||
import { MiLock, MiImagePlus, MiIcVpnKey } from 'commoncomponents';
|
||||
|
||||
export default {
|
||||
components: {
|
|
@ -17,7 +17,7 @@
|
|||
</template>
|
||||
|
||||
<script>
|
||||
import { MiLock } from '../ui/components/common/MaterialIcon';
|
||||
import { MiLock } from 'commoncomponents';
|
||||
|
||||
export default {
|
||||
components: {
|
|
@ -0,0 +1,3 @@
|
|||
export { default as default } from './E2EE';
|
||||
export { default as E2EEComponent } from './E2EEComponent.vue';
|
||||
export { default as E2EEMessageButton } from './E2EEMessageButton.vue';
|
|
@ -9,18 +9,11 @@
|
|||
*/
|
||||
|
||||
import { Settings } from 'modules';
|
||||
|
||||
import BuiltinModule from './BuiltinModule';
|
||||
import EmoteModule from './EmoteModule';
|
||||
import GlobalAc from '../ui/autocomplete';
|
||||
import BuiltinModule from '../BuiltinModule';
|
||||
import EmoteModule, { EMOTE_SOURCES } from './EmoteModule';
|
||||
import GlobalAc from 'autocomplete';
|
||||
import { BdContextMenu } from 'ui';
|
||||
|
||||
const EMOTE_SOURCES = [
|
||||
'https://static-cdn.jtvnw.net/emoticons/v1/:id/1.0',
|
||||
'https://cdn.frankerfacez.com/emoticon/:id/1',
|
||||
'https://cdn.betterttv.net/emote/:id/1x'
|
||||
]
|
||||
|
||||
export default new class EmoteAc extends BuiltinModule {
|
||||
|
||||
/* Getters */
|
|
@ -8,15 +8,10 @@
|
|||
* LICENSE file in the root directory of this source tree.
|
||||
*/
|
||||
|
||||
import VrWrapper from '../ui/vrwrapper';
|
||||
import VrWrapper from '../../ui/vrwrapper';
|
||||
import { EMOTE_SOURCES } from '.';
|
||||
import EmoteComponent from './EmoteComponent.vue';
|
||||
|
||||
const EMOTE_SOURCES = [
|
||||
'https://static-cdn.jtvnw.net/emoticons/v1/:id/1.0',
|
||||
'https://cdn.frankerfacez.com/emoticon/:id/1',
|
||||
'https://cdn.betterttv.net/emote/:id/1x'
|
||||
]
|
||||
|
||||
export default class Emote extends VrWrapper {
|
||||
|
||||
constructor(type, id, name) {
|
|
@ -5,7 +5,7 @@
|
|||
<script>
|
||||
import { ClientLogger as Logger } from 'common';
|
||||
import EmoteModule from './EmoteModule';
|
||||
import { MiStar } from '../ui/components/common';
|
||||
import { MiStar } from 'commoncomponents';
|
||||
|
||||
export default {
|
||||
components: {
|
|
@ -8,7 +8,7 @@
|
|||
* LICENSE file in the root directory of this source tree.
|
||||
*/
|
||||
|
||||
import BuiltinModule from './BuiltinModule';
|
||||
import BuiltinModule from '../BuiltinModule';
|
||||
import path from 'path';
|
||||
import { request } from 'vendor';
|
||||
|
||||
|
@ -17,11 +17,8 @@ import { DiscordApi, Settings, Globals, Reflection, ReactComponents, Database }
|
|||
import { DiscordContextMenu } from 'ui';
|
||||
|
||||
import Emote from './EmoteComponent.js';
|
||||
import Autocomplete from '../ui/components/common/Autocomplete.vue';
|
||||
|
||||
import GlobalAc from '../ui/autocomplete';
|
||||
|
||||
const EMOTE_SOURCES = [
|
||||
export const EMOTE_SOURCES = [
|
||||
'https://static-cdn.jtvnw.net/emoticons/v1/:id/1.0',
|
||||
'https://cdn.frankerfacez.com/emoticon/:id/1',
|
||||
'https://cdn.betterttv.net/emote/:id/1x'
|
|
@ -0,0 +1,4 @@
|
|||
export { default as EmoteModule, EMOTE_SOURCES } from './EmoteModule';
|
||||
export { default as Emote } from './EmoteComponent';
|
||||
export { default as EmoteComponent } from './EmoteComponent.vue';
|
||||
export { default as EmoteAc } from './EmoteAc';
|
|
@ -1,4 +1,4 @@
|
|||
import { default as EmoteModule } from './EmoteModule';
|
||||
import { EmoteModule, EmoteAc } from './Emotes';
|
||||
import { default as ReactDevtoolsModule } from './ReactDevtoolsModule';
|
||||
import { default as VueDevtoolsModule } from './VueDevToolsModule';
|
||||
import { default as TrackingProtection } from './TrackingProtection';
|
||||
|
@ -8,7 +8,6 @@ import { default as TwentyFourHour } from './24Hour';
|
|||
import { default as KillClyde } from './KillClyde';
|
||||
import { default as BlockedMessages } from './BlockedMessages';
|
||||
import { default as VoiceDisconnect } from './VoiceDisconnect';
|
||||
import { default as EmoteAc } from './EmoteAc';
|
||||
|
||||
export default class {
|
||||
static initAll() {
|
||||
|
|
|
@ -1,4 +1,4 @@
|
|||
export { default as EmoteModule } from './EmoteModule';
|
||||
export { EmoteModule, EmoteAc } from './Emotes';
|
||||
export { default as ReactDevtoolsModule } from './ReactDevtoolsModule';
|
||||
export { default as VueDevtoolsModule } from './VueDevToolsModule';
|
||||
export { default as TrackingProtection } from './TrackingProtection';
|
||||
|
|
Loading…
Reference in New Issue